About the International Fund for Public Interest Media
The International Fund provides a fresh, ambitious, coordinated, and well-resourced strategic international response to the crisis facing independent media around the world. The International Fund launched its First Phase of Operations in 2023 and established its independent headquarters in Paris, France in 2024 and received the status of an international organization in France.
The International Fund is the world's only multilateral mechanism responding to the existential threats facing public interest media in low- and middle-income countries. First announced at the inaugural Summit for Democracy in 2021, the International Fund is designed to pool resources and expertise to boost the economic resilience of media markets. The International Fund's grants provide direct core funding to media outlets in need and help develop long-term sustainable media markets, including through experimentation with national funds and new regulatory approaches. The International Fund complements existing efforts in the media development sector, catalyzing new money as a globally coordinated but fully independent vehicle.
The International Fund is co-chaired by Maria Ressa, journalist, CEO of Rappler, and 2021 Nobel Peace Prize laureate, and Sir Mark Thompson, CEO of CNN and former CEO of the New York Times Company and Director General of the BBC. More details can be found at:
The Role
The Finance Manager will play a pivotal role in supporting the Finance Director to ensure accurate and timely bookkeeping and donor reporting, robust internal controls, and effective financial risk management.
This position requires a highly organized, proactive individual who can manage multiple priorities, navigate complex environments, and ensure financial transparency and compliance.
This position will grow as the Fund's operations scale-up, with the potential to supervise other members of the finance team as the organization grows.
Key Responsibilities
- Leading Fund's Accounting & Donor Reporting (80%)
The Finance Manager will lead the Fund's accounting function, ensuring timely bookeeping, expense allocation, and donor reporting. This will include the following responsibilities:
o Accounting & Expense Management: ensure timely and accurate bookkeeping, together with HR Business Partner supervise outsourced payroll processes, coordinate the creation and execution of payments, manage the Fund's accounting system updates.
o Financial Planning & Analysis: manage budgets, forecasts, and cash flow planning;
o Manage donor reporting: review donor funding agreements to understand financial reporting requirements and related compliance obligations, perform donor-specific expense allocations, and collaborate with External Relations colleagues to manage and submit accurate and timely reports to donors.
o Audit Preparation: collaborate with the Finance Director to coordinate and prepare for internal and external audits, ensuring readiness and compliance with relevant obligations.
- Internal Control & Compliance (20%)
The Finance Manager will strengthen the Fund's internal financial controls through performing the following functions:
o Internal Control Reviews: conduct formal annual reviews of the Fund's internal controls. Ensure documentation is up-to-date and properly archived in line with data retention and other policies, and that all controls are operating effectively and in line with established internal policies.
o Internal Audit Recommendations Follow-Up: implement and monitor progress on recommendations provided by external auditors or following internal audits, ensuring timely and effective resolution of any identified issues or gaps.
